The first step in identifying their problem
Understanding your target audience is the first step towards the lead magnet strategy. What do they need? What are their concerns? What are their issues? How can you assist them to achieve what they want but are unable to get from you? Buyer personas are a great tool. Identifying the first step of their issue will allow you to develop an offer that will actually aid them in solving their problem.

Create a calendar
Calendars are a great way to develop an lead magnet. They can be simple or complex, and help your audience plan their schedules for the coming days. You can also make a calendar that is focused on projects to help your audience reach the goal they have set for themselves. Whatever calendar you create, make sure it is relevant to your audience. The more personal it is, the more likely people will be to use it and become your customers.
Making a report
A lead magnet report is one of the most effective ways to generate leads for your marketing campaign. It should contain both resource- and knowledge-based content. You can either look at the content libraries of your competition to get ideas or find out what your target audience is seeking. You might consider asking your audience members for suggestions when you are writing an analysis for a B2B company.
